【0001】[0001]
【発明の属する技術分野】この発明はドアと下枠間の気
密性を確保するドアの気密装置に関するものである。B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a door airtightness device for ensuring airtightness between a door and a lower frame.
【0002】[0002]
【従来の技術及び発明が解決しようとする課題】縦軸回
りに回転して開閉するドアと下枠間で気密性を確保する
気密装置は実開昭55-13729号,実開昭61−120893号等の
ようにドアの下端部に昇降自在に内蔵され、下端に気密
材が敷設されたドアボトムと、ドアの閉鎖時に吊り元側
の縦枠に接触してドアボトムを降下させるロッドと、開
放時にドアボトムを上昇させるバネから構成されるが、
いずれもドアの建て入れ時の、ロッドのドアからの突出
長さの調整がドライバーでロッドを回すことにより行わ
れるため、操作しにくい上、ドアの閉鎖時にはロッドが
直接縦枠に接触するため、接触時にロッドと縦枠に衝撃
を加える問題がある。2. Description of the Related Art An airtight device for ensuring airtightness between a door and a lower frame which opens and closes by rotating about a vertical axis is disclosed in Japanese Utility Model Laid-Open Nos. 55-13729 and 61-120893. No., etc., is built into the lower end of the door so as to be able to move up and down freely, and a door bottom with an airtight material laid at the lower end, a rod that contacts the vertical frame on the hanging side when closing the door and lowers the door bottom, It is composed of a spring that raises the door bottom,
In any case, since the adjustment of the length of the rod protruding from the door when opening the door is performed by turning the rod with a driver, it is difficult to operate, and when the door is closed, the rod directly contacts the vertical frame, There is a problem that impact is applied to the rod and the vertical frame at the time of contact.
【0003】また実開昭61−120893号のように縦軸が下
枠に設置されるフロアヒンジの場合にはドアボトムをフ
ロアヒンジと干渉させない必要から、ドアボトムがフロ
アヒンジより戸先側に位置するため、ドアボトムの気密
材によってはフロアヒンジの回りの気密性を確保するこ
とができない。In the case of a floor hinge whose vertical axis is installed in a lower frame as in Japanese Utility Model Application Laid-Open No. 61-120893, the door bottom must not interfere with the floor hinge. Therefore, the airtightness around the floor hinge cannot be ensured depending on the airtight material of the door bottom.
【0004】この発明は上記問題を解消し、従来の気密
装置とは異なる形態の気密装置を提案するものである。The present invention solves the above problem and proposes an airtight device having a form different from that of a conventional airtight device.
